Mark Nonoy, Deo Cuajao bid UST goodbye amid probe into 'Sorsogon bubble'

Mark Nonoy and Deo Cuajao have joined the list of players leaving the University of Santo Tomas in the aftermath of the "Sorsogon bubble" controversy.

In separate statements on Monday, the two players announced their departure from the Growling Tigers.

"Napakabigat man para sa loob ko, kinakailangan ko ng katiyakan sa aking career para makapagfocus ulit sa basketball," said Nonoy, the UAAP season 82 Rookie of the Year.

"Ilang araw na hindi ako makatulog kasi napamahal na ang team sakin," Cuajao said. "Ang tanging hangad ko lang ay maglaro ng basketball kaya ang hirap talaga mag decide."

The two players expressed concern about the future of the team. The UAAP has handed down an indefinite ban on resigned head coach Aldin Ayo, while UST is still facing probe

from government agencies.

Nonoy and Cuajao did not disclose where they would transfer, but they thanked the UST community for giving them opportunity to show what they can do.

"Ano man natutunan ko sa UST dadalhin ko 'yan habambuhay saan man ako mapunta," Nonoy said. "Akin po munang kokonsultahin ang aking pamilya para sa mga susunod na hakbang na aming gagawin."

The pair also tipped their hats off to Ayo for taking a chance on them and giving them confidence on the court.

Other Tigers who left the team include former team captain CJ Cansino, Brent Paraiso, Rhenz Abando, Ira Bataller, and Jun Asuncion—MGP, GMA News
